Installation & Maintenance Guide
Common Issues & Solutions:
Noise or Vibrations: Often caused by air cavitation or contamination.
Solution: Check for air leaks in the suction line, ensure proper fluid level, and inspect the inlet filter for clogs. Flush the system to remove contaminants.
Loss of Power or Sluggish Operation: May be due to internal wear, incorrect fluid viscosity, or a faulty relief valve.
Solution: Verify that the correct hydraulic fluid is being used. Inspect the pump for signs of internal leakage. A pressure test can confirm if the pump is failing.
Overheating: Can be caused by a dirty heat exchanger, low fluid level, or a worn pump.
Solution: Clean the heat exchanger fins. Top up the hydraulic fluid. If the issue persists, the pump may need to be replaced due to internal friction from wear.
